IE 7 adding extra top padding

The menu on my page is being pushed down in IE 7 and I can't figure out why. It looks fine in Chrome. There is another text box that is also getting extra top-padding. Can someone take a look and see what might be causing this? The page is

Brian Pringle
What program did you use to generate the page?
I used Dreamweaver, but most of it is hand coded.
Thanks, I found the problem. it was the method I was using to include the file. I was using
Response.WriteFile ("")
and when I changed that to an #include
it worked. I don't know why though